The Asia/Oceania Zone will be one of the three regional zones of the 2019 Davis Cup.
In the Asia/Oceania Zone there are four different tiers, called groups. The winners of the Group I ties in September will earn a place in the 2020 Davis Cup Qualifiers, while the remaining nations in Groups I and II will be allocated a place within their region depending on their position in the Nations Ranking.[1]
